Description:
1. Material : Imported high quality raw materials , high corrosion resistance , by the refining production, has the equilibrium and stability of hardness.
2. Head : Circular cutting edge is good to prevent the steps and impalement .
3. Special process : specially designed, if broken, broken parts is closed to handle, which is easy to remove from the root canal .
4. Handle : Each has a ring logo to distinguish , used for preparation of upper 1/3 root canal crown ; to bring out the filled material in the root canal; to prepare the post path .
5. Recommended Rotary Speed : 800~1200 rmp
Use Protocol:
1) Pre-operative sterilization.
2) Place rubber dam or other suitable isolation technique.
3) Root canal preparation. Ensure that sufficient space exists to place the post. Remove residual gutta percha out of the pulp chamber and canal orifice.
4) Select the correct Fiber Post size, according to the anatomical situation of tooth using the radiograph and the size table above.
Select the Peeso Reamer and Precision Drill corresponding to the selected Fiber Post size.
5) Wear rubber dam etc . to avoid accidental ingestion and falling .
6) Do not use this instrument for any purposes except for listed applications above .
7) Only for use by dentists .
8) After using , follow an appropriate treatment as medical waste .
9) Dispose the product if damaged or contaminated .
10) After using , wash it with medical cleaning agent and brush , then wash away foreign substances like adherent body fluids and body tissues .
11) Set the handle plugger to a stand when cleaned by ultrasonic cleaner to avoid working part deterioration .
12) Use handle plugger with great care to avoid puncturing fingers because of its possession of sharp-edged part.

Maintenances and Inspections:
1. Sterilize this product by autoclave under established method and term for each use.
Method of sterilization:
Put this product in a sterilization pack or (or foil) and place it on a sterilization tray, or files stand for
autoclave sterilization with reference to the following terms.
Terms for sterilization :
term ( 1 ) temperature : 121degrees Celsius time: 20 minutes or more
term ( 2 ) temperature : 126degrees Celsius time: 15 minutes or more
2. Do not use high pressure steam sterilizer which heats more than 200 degrees Celsius including drying process .
3. When reusing the instrument, wash away foreign substances completely and sterilize .
4. Regarding use of medical cleaning agent, follow the instruction manual by its manufacturer strictly .
5. Dispose the product if damaged or decreased in performance
